Obituary for Louise Montclare (Castaldi)

Louise Montclare of Scarsdale, New York passed away unexpectedly on September 23, 2012 at the age of 93. Beloved mother, grandmother and great grandmother, Louise graduated from Hunter college at the age of 19 with a Bachelor of Science degree in Biology, had a successful career as a businesswoman and taught high school biology at Eastchester High School for 25 years. After her retirement from teaching, she began a career in journalism at the age of 65, where she served as editor-in-chief for 7 newspapers in Westchester owned by the Martinelli chain. She was the winner of numerous awards for competitive ballroom dancing well into her 80's,and hosted a local interview and call-in radio talk show at WVOX until her death. She was a mentor, friend and inspiration to those who knew her and to everyone whose lives she touched. She is survived by her sons, Sandy, Paul and Joseph Montclare, their wives, six grandchildren and five great grandchildren.
